One of the most-streamed Czech artists and the country’s most successful Eurovision representative – MIKOLAS – is returning after seven years to the place where his career in the Czech Republic first began. Forum Karlín, the venue of his very first solo concert, will in December 2026 become the stage for another defining chapter of his musical story.
Following his multi-platinum debut album ONE, which redefined the standard of Czech pop on the international stage, MIKOLAS achieved a global breakthrough with his single “Delilah”, which reached the Top 20 in more than 25 countries, marking a new historic success for Czech music. The album has already surpassed 130 million streams, and after two sold-out comeback shows at Prague’s legendary Lucerna Hall, MIKOLAS is now preparing for a moment that promises to surpass everything his fans have seen so far.
After a series of international performances, including Japan, MIKOLAS will present his upcoming third studio album “III” in the biggest and most elaborate show of his career – featuring a live band, massive stage design, and a visually striking production that will take his artistry to the next level.
“I’m returning to Forum Karlín after seven years. It’s a place my fans hold close to their hearts as the site of our very first meeting. Now it’s time to come back – stronger, more experienced, and with the best work I’ve ever done,” says MIKOLAS.
